NaPoWriMo #4 : Vision Thing

Vision Thing


Vision has a look here dance naked quality


While some vision has "you kids aren't going to want to see that" finger wag


Other vision says beyond THIS, there's a sweet valley we have not yet tasted


As another vision rocks in its arms dreams of freedom, rebirth and transcendence.


That vision thing tangles with this vision thing into a tumbleweed of vision rings to a roll across vast vision-less fields


and sings. Yes, she sings.


She does.


Many eyes tied to many hearts, that one love ( yes, yes - that one )


that tumbleweed of desperate dreams


sing that, vision thing


You're a bundle of better angels, a choir of thorns with wings.
